Scientists have found a way to double the speed of computer calculations without replacing hardware
At the 56th Annual IEEE/ACM International Symposium on Microarchitecture, researchers from the University of California, Riverside (UCR) demonstrated an approach in which any computing component on a platform would truly run concurrently. Due to this, you can double the speed of calculations and halve energy consumption. The technology can work on any processors and accelerators from smartphones to data center servers, but requires further development.
